In a sun‑drenched Italian landscape, the daring knight Orlando first encounters the mysterious lady Morgana within a fragrant myrtle grove, where fruit and flower mingle in a riot of colors. Their meeting sparks a quest that threads through enchanted towers, wild wilderness, and the shifting whims of Fortune herself. The tale balances bold chivalry with a playful humor, inviting listeners to follow Orlando’s courtly pursuits and the magical obstacles that test his resolve.

Presented in clear prose yet threaded with original stanzaic fragments, the translation preserves the lyrical spirit of the 15th‑century romance while making the story accessible to modern ears. Listeners will be drawn into a world where courtly love, daring battles, and fantastical creatures intertwine, all set against a backdrop of vivid scenery and witty banter. The early chapters lay the foundation for a sprawling adventure that promises both romance and intrigue without revealing the twists that lie ahead.

About the author

MM

Matteo Maria Boiardo

1440–1494

A court poet of Renaissance Ferrara, he helped revive the chivalric epic by blending the worlds of Charlemagne and King Arthur in the lively, unfinished Orlando innamorato. His verse also moved in a more personal direction, especially in the love poems gathered as Amorum libri tres.
